. The perimeter of a rectangle is 38 inches. If the length is 3 inches more than the width, find the width.

Answer:

  • w = 8 inches

Step-by-step explanation:

P = 2w + 2l

l = 3 + w

38 = 2w + 2(3 + w)

38 = 2w + 6 + 2w

38 - 6 = 4w

32 = 4w

w = 32 : 4

w = 8 inches

l = 3 + w

l = 3inches + 8inches

l = 11 inches
